package org.apache.pdfbox.pdmodel.documentinterchange.taggedpdf;
import org.apache.pdfbox.cos.COSArray;
import org.apache.pdfbox.cos.COSBase;
import org.apache.pdfbox.cos.COSNull;
import org.apache.pdfbox.pdmodel.common.COSObjectable;
import org.apache.pdfbox.pdmodel.graphics.color.PDGamma;
/**
* An object for four colours.
*
* @author Johannes Koch
*/
public class PDFourColours implements COSObjectable
{
private final COSArray array;
public PDFourColours()
{
this.array = new COSArray();
this.array.add(COSNull.NULL);
this.array.add(COSNull.NULL);
this.array.add(COSNull.NULL);
this.array.add(COSNull.NULL);
}
public PDFourColours(COSArray array)
{
this.array = array;
// ensure that array has 4 items
if (this.array.size() < 4)
{
for (int i = (this.array.size() - 1); i < 4; i++)
{
this.array.add(COSNull.NULL);
}
}
}
/**
* Gets the colour for the before edge.
*
* @return the colour for the before edge
*/
public PDGamma getBeforeColour()
{
return this.getColourByIndex(0);
}
/**
* Sets the colour for the before edge.
*
* @param colour the colour for the before edge
*/
public void setBeforeColour(PDGamma colour)
{
this.setColourByIndex(0, colour);
}
/**
* Gets the colour for the after edge.
*
* @return the colour for the after edge
*/
public PDGamma getAfterColour()
{
return this.getColourByIndex(1);
}
/**
* Sets the colour for the after edge.
*
* @param colour the colour for the after edge
*/
public void setAfterColour(PDGamma colour)
{
this.setColourByIndex(1, colour);
}
/**
* Gets the colour for the start edge.
*
* @return the colour for the start edge
*/
public PDGamma getStartColour()
{
return this.getColourByIndex(2);
}
/**
* Sets the colour for the start edge.
*
* @param colour the colour for the start edge
*/
public void setStartColour(PDGamma colour)
{
this.setColourByIndex(2, colour);
}
/**
* Gets the colour for the end edge.
*
* @return the colour for the end edge
*/
public PDGamma getEndColour()
{
return this.getColourByIndex(3);
}
/**
* Sets the colour for the end edge.
*
* @param colour the colour for the end edge
*/
public void setEndColour(PDGamma colour)
{
this.setColourByIndex(3, colour);
}
/**
* {@inheritDoc}
*/
@Override
public COSBase getCOSObject()
{
return this.array;
}
/**
* Gets the colour by edge index.
*
* @param index edge index
* @return the colour
*/
private PDGamma getColourByIndex(int index)
{
PDGamma retval = null;
COSBase item = this.array.getObject(index);
if (item instanceof COSArray)
{
retval = new PDGamma((COSArray) item);
}
return retval;
}
/**
* Sets the colour by edge index.
*
* @param index the edge index
* @param colour the colour
*/
private void setColourByIndex(int index, PDGamma colour)
{
COSBase base;
if (colour == null)
{
base = COSNull.NULL;
}
else
{
base = colour.getCOSArray();
}
this.array.set(index, base);
}
}
